As a veteran with years of experience in the automotive industry, I don't consider fuel tank cleaners absolutely necessary, but they can be helpful in specific situations. If your car is frequently driven on short trips in the city or if the local gasoline quality is poor, carbon deposits can easily build up in the fuel system. Using a cleaner can help clean the fuel injectors and valves, improving combustion efficiency and potentially saving some fuel costs. However, modern gasoline already contains cleaning additives, so new cars or well-maintained vehicles can skip this expense. I recommend using a reputable brand every 5,000 kilometers or during oil changes—this way, you avoid wasting money while preventing minor issues. Excessive use may corrode rubber components, especially the seals in older cars. In short, moderate use is wise; don't treat it as a daily essential. Pay attention to your car's performance before deciding.

I've been driving a family car for over ten years and only occasionally add fuel system cleaners when refueling. When the car feels sluggish or fuel consumption increases, a single can usually solves the problem, making the engine run smoother. These additives cost 20 to 30 yuan per bottle, which isn't expensive, but frequent use can accumulate into significant costs. From experience, most cars in normal condition don't need them, but neglecting for too long may lead to carbon buildup and higher repair costs. So I've found a middle ground: using reputable cleaners about twice a year for targeted maintenance. The key is to consider personal driving habits; those who frequently drive on highways may benefit more, while urban commuters might not need them as much. Think of fuel system cleaners as preventive medicine—use them wisely rather than blindly following advertisements.

As a young enthusiast who enjoys studying automotive technology, I find fuel system cleaners quite redundant in modern vehicles. Today's gasoline already contains highly effective detergents, and new cars rarely experience carbon buildup issues even after tens of thousands of kilometers. I've only tried using cleaners when driving my father's old car or traveling to remote areas, with mediocre results and no noticeable improvement. After researching, I learned that frequent use might interfere with the engine's natural cleaning mechanisms. It's best to follow the manual's guidance: only use reputable products when symptoms like engine shuddering occur. Simple maintenance with minimal intervention works best.

As a long-haul trucker, fuel system cleaners are crucial for me. Under high-load driving conditions, engines are prone to carbon buildup. Regular use of fuel system cleaners protects the system, reduces wear and extends engine life. Adding a high-quality product every 10,000 kilometers shows noticeable effects: improved power and slightly reduced fuel consumption. However, it's essential to choose quality-guaranteed products as inferior cleaners may damage components. Adjust usage based on vehicle condition: new vehicles can skip it, while older vehicles must use it. Consulting a mechanic is safer.

what does jeep stand for

Jeep does not officially stand for anything, though many believe it comes from the military term "G.P." for "General Purpose" vehicle used in World War II. The name also gained popularity from soldiers pronouncing "G.P." as "Jeep." Today, Jeep is recognized as a brand of rugged SUVs and off-road vehicles, known for durability and versatility.

how to buff scratches off a car

Begin by washing your car to get rid of dirt and check the scratch depth. Light scratches can be treated with scratch remover or polish to even out the surface. For more serious marks, lightly sand the area, apply touch-up paint, and seal with a clear coat. Once dry, polish and wax the section to match the rest of the paintwork.

what is a lien on a car

A car lien is a legal claim a lender or creditor has on a vehicle to secure a debt, recorded on the car's title. The lienholder, usually the loan provider, can repossess the car if payments aren't made. Liens remain until the debt is fully paid, after which the owner receives a clear title. Liens can be voluntary, like auto loans, or involuntary, such as tax, mechanic's, or judgment liens.

how many cars does jay leno have

Located near Burbank Airport, Jay Leno’s Big Dog Garage stores about 181 cars and 160 motorcycles. The collection features everything from classic cars and modern high-performance supercars to unique and unusual vehicles. Although he occasionally buys and sells cars, Leno is very selective, having sold only one car over the past 30 years.
